DebianにWebminをインストールする方法

あなたはシステム管理者ですか? 黒と白のコンソール画面での作業退屈? なぜWebminを試してみませんか? Webminは、システムを制御するための素敵なwebベースのインターフェイスを提供するツールです。 あなたは、任意の近代的なwebブラウザを使用して、リモートでそれにアクセスすることができます。 サーバー構成、パッケージ管理、ユーザーとグループの管理、ディスククォータなど、システムのほぼすべての部分を管理できます。

このガイドでは、DebianにWebminをインストールする方法を確認してください。

前提条件

Debianでシステム変更を実行するには、rootアカウントまたはsudo権限を持つユーザーにアクセスできる必要があります。 同じことがWebminのインストールにも当てはまります。

サーバーがファイアウォールを実行している場合は、Webminトラフィックを許可するように構成する必要があります。 このガイドでは、デフォルトとしてUFWを使用します。

Webminのインストール

rootアカウント(またはsudo特権を持つアカウント)へのアクセス権があると仮定して、Webminのインストールを始めましょう。

DebianにWebminをインストールするには二つの方法があります。 最初のものは、Webmin DEBパッケージを取得し、手動でインストールすることを含みます。 第二の方法は、Webmin APTリポジトリを構成することです。 APTは自動的にWebminを最新の状態に保つため、2番目の方法を使用することをお勧めします。

Webmin DEBパッケージ

Webmin DEBパッケージを取得します。

ダウンロードが完了したら、それをインストールする時間です。 DEBパッケージをインストールするには、必要な依存関係を自動的に決定してインストールするため、APTを使用するのが最善のアイデアです。

$ apt更新&&aptインストール。/ウェブミン_1.955_all.デブ

Webmin APT repo

Webminは、すべてのDebianおよびDebianベースのディストリビューション(Ubuntu、Linux Mintなど)用のAPT repoを提供しています。

まず、以下のコンポーネントをインストールします。

$ apt update&&apt install software-properties-common apt-transport-https wget

次のステップは、Webmin GPGキーを追加することです。

$ wget-qhttp://www.webmin.com/jcameron-key.asc-O-|apt-key add-

システムはWebmin repoを追加する準備ができています。

$ add-apt-repository”debhttp://download.webmin.com/download/repository
sarge contrib”

APTリポジトリが正常に追加されました。 APTキャッシュを更新します。

$ aptアップデート

WebminリポジトリからWebminをインストールします。

$ aptインストールwebmin-y

ファイアウォールの設定

デフォルトでは、Webminはすべてのネットワークインターフェイス上のポート10000をリッスンします。 サーバーがファイアウォールを使用していると仮定すると、ポート10000でトラフィックを許可する必要があります。

サーバーがUFWを使用している場合は、次のコマンドを実行してポート10000を開きます。

$ ufwは10000/tcpを許可します

サーバーが接続のフィルタリングにnftablesを使用している場合は、次のコマンドを実行します。

$ nft add rule inet filter input tcp dport10000ct state new,established counter accept

Using Webmin

Webminが正常に構成されました。 Webminダッシュボードにアクセスするには、次のURLに移動します。 任意の現代のブラウザは、仕事をします。

$ https://<server_ip_or_hostname>:10000/

Webminは、サーバーのログイン資格情報を要求します。

これはWebminのダッシュボードです。 サーバーに関する基本的な情報を報告します。

のは、いくつかの便利なショートカットを簡単に見てみましょう。 左側のパネルから、システム>>ソフトウェアパッケージの更新に移動します。 ここから、パッケージの更新を管理できます。

パッケージをインストールまたはアップグレードするには、System>>Software Packagesに移動します。

ファイアウォールを管理するには、Networking>>Linux Firewallに移動します。 Ipv6ファイアウォールの場合は、Networking>>Linux Ipv6Firewallに移動します。

Webminの動作を設定するには、Webmin>>Webminの設定に移動します。

Webminインターフェイスに、より快適な外観をしたいですか? ナイトモードをオンにします。

Webminを使用してコンソールでコマンドを実行するには、他の>>コマンドシェルに移動します。

最終的な考え

Webminは、システム管理者のための信じられないほどのソフトウェアです。 これは、コンソールを使用して作業することなく、システムのさまざまな部分へのより便利なアクセスを提供しています。 完全にWebminをマスターするために、オンラインで利用可能なチュートリアルがたくさんあります。 最も詳細な情報については、公式のWebmin wikiをチェックしてください。

UbuntuでWebminを設定することに興味がありますか? UbuntuにWebminをインストールして設定する方法については、このガイドを参照してください。

コメントを残す

メールアドレスが公開されることはありません。